AI Fortune Telling Accuracy: Evidence-Based Assessment
Is AI fortune telling accurate? An honest, evidence-based look at what AI BaZi analysis can and cannot do, backed by 2,494 automated test results | deeporacle.ai
Is AI Fortune Telling Accurate? A Question That Needs Unpacking
"Is AI fortune telling accurate?" is probably the first question anyone asks when encountering AI-powered BaZi (Chinese astrology) analysis. But the question itself is flawed — it assumes accuracy is binary, a simple yes or no.
In reality, BaZi analysis operates across multiple dimensions with varying degrees of certainty. Some analytical dimensions can achieve very high accuracy. Others are inherently probabilistic. This is not an AI limitation — it is a characteristic of Chinese metaphysics itself.
Consider these examples:
- Chart pattern determination: Given a birth chart, identifying whether it is a Direct Officer pattern, Indirect Resource pattern, or Eating God pattern follows clear classical rules. The answer is deterministic. AI performs very reliably here. - Useful God (yongshen) derivation: Based on the chart pattern and day master strength, determining the most beneficial element involves clear logic but more weighing of factors. Certainty is slightly lower. - Specific event timing: Predicting exactly which year someone will get married or promoted is the least certain dimension of BaZi analysis. Any system claiming 100% accuracy here is not trustworthy.
So rather than asking "is AI fortune telling accurate," the more meaningful questions are: In which dimensions is AI BaZi analysis reliable? Where are its limits? Is there quantifiable evidence for its reliability?
This article answers those questions with real test data, honestly showing what Deep Oracle can and cannot do.
What AI BaZi Analysis Does Well
1. Consistent Application of Classical Rules
An experienced human practitioner might be deeply versed in the Zi Ping Zhen Quan格局 theory but occasionally overlook a relevant passage from the Di Tian Sui in a specific analysis. This is not a competence issue — human attention has natural limits.
AI does not have this problem. Deep Oracle's deterministic engines execute all relevant rules completely in every analysis — no fatigue, no mood effects, no forgetfulness.
2. Zero Bias Analysis
Human practitioners can be unconsciously influenced by a client's appearance, emotional state, or social status. A well-dressed client might receive a more "positive" reading. AI works only with birth data. The same birth chart produces the same core analysis every time. This consistency is itself a form of reliability.
3. Multi-School Cross-Reference
Most traditional practitioners specialize in one or two schools of thought. Deep Oracle's engines integrate four major methodologies simultaneously:
- Zi Ping school: Pattern and Useful God system - Blind school: Direct reading techniques - Qiong Tong Bao Jian school: Seasonal adjustment - Modern school: Balance-based Useful God
When all four schools agree on a Useful God determination, confidence is very high. When they disagree, the system flags the divergence rather than arbitrarily picking one result.
4. Traceable Calculation Logic
Every Useful God determination, pattern identification, and strength score has a clear logic chain behind it. You can trace exactly which rule triggered a particular conclusion. This transparency means anyone with basic BaZi knowledge can verify the reasoning.
5. 2,494 Automated Tests Across 8 Engines
This is our strongest evidence. Deep Oracle's eight deterministic engines are backed by 2,494 automated test cases covering:
| Engine | Coverage | |--------|----------| | Useful God (Yongshen) | 188 tests across 4 schools | | Chart Pattern | Complete zheng-ge and bian-ge identification | | Five Element Flow | Generating and controlling relationships | | Strength Scoring | Season, roots, transparency scoring | | Ten Gods | Complete ten god derivation | | Six Relations | Family relationship mapping | | Fortune Rating | Luck pillar and annual fortune scoring | | Life Level | Comprehensive chart quality assessment |
These tests run automatically with every code update. If any single test fails, the code does not ship. This is engineering-grade quality assurance.
The Real Limitations of AI BaZi Analysis
Honesty about limitations builds more trust than overclaiming. Here is what AI BaZi analysis currently cannot do well.
1. Only Works With Birth Data
Traditional practitioners can combine face reading, palm reading, and intuitive perception of a client's energy. An experienced master might use someone's posture or speaking manner to cross-validate their chart reading. AI currently works with only four data points: year, month, day, and hour of birth.
2. Constrained by Training Data Quality
Large language models learn from their training data. If that data includes low-quality metaphysics content (and the internet has plenty), the model's output can be affected. This is precisely why Deep Oracle uses the hybrid architecture — we do not rely on the LLM's metaphysics "knowledge." The deterministic engines compute all analytical facts first.
3. May Miss Subtle Chart Interactions
Some BaZi chart combinations involve extremely subtle interaction effects — rare hidden combinations, complex three-way dynamics between branches. Seasoned practitioners develop intuitive pattern recognition for these through decades of practice. While Deep Oracle's engines cover clashes, combinations, punishments, harms, destructions, hidden combinations, and more, we acknowledge that some rare patterns may still be missed.
4. LLM Prose Can Be Generic
Without the constraint of deterministic engines, LLM-generated BaZi readings tend toward "one size fits all" statements that sound applicable to anyone. This is exactly why the deterministic engines are critical — they provide specific, verified analytical anchor points for the LLM's writing.
5. No Interactive Deep-Dive Dialogue (Yet)
Current AI BaZi analysis is a one-shot process: you enter your birth time, you receive a complete report. In traditional consultations, practitioners ask follow-up questions and refine their analysis based on your feedback. AI cannot yet do this kind of contextual deep-dive, though it is part of our development roadmap.
Deep Oracle's Technical Approach: Deterministic Engines + LLM
Understanding how Deep Oracle works is key to understanding the accuracy question.
Most "AI fortune telling" products simply send your birth information to ChatGPT or a similar LLM and let the model calculate the chart and generate analysis on its own. The problems with this approach are clear: LLMs have limited mathematical ability and frequently miscalculate stems and branches. Their metaphysics knowledge comes from mixed-quality internet content. Their output cannot be verified.
Deep Oracle uses a fundamentally different architecture:
1. Deterministic engines first: Eight independent engines (implemented in code, not AI) complete all calculations — chart construction, strength scoring, pattern determination, Useful God derivation, fortune rating, and life level assessment. Each engine has dozens to hundreds of unit tests ensuring correctness.
2. LLM writes from verified facts: The language model receives not a prompt saying "please analyze this chart" but a complete data package of pre-computed analysis. The LLM's job is to transform these deterministic facts into readable prose.
This means that even if the LLM's metaphysics knowledge has gaps, the core analytical conclusions are still determined by engines verified through 2,494 tests.
When AI Is More Reliable Than Humans
AI BaZi analysis typically outperforms or matches human practitioners in these scenarios:
- Pattern determination: Pure rule-based work with high consistency and accuracy. - Useful God derivation: 188 test cases across four schools ensure logical correctness. - Branch interaction identification: Complete identification of clashes, combinations, punishments, and hidden combinations that humans might overlook in complex charts. - Luck pillar calculation: Pure computation — AI does not make arithmetic errors. - Spirit star identification: Complete checking of 38 spirit stars in every analysis. - Multi-school comparison: Simultaneously presenting four schools' perspectives.
The pattern is clear: the more rule-based and logically derivable an analytical dimension is, the more reliable AI performs.
When Human Practitioners Still Have the Edge
Experienced human practitioners retain clear advantages in:
- Holistic perception: Integrating face reading, palm reading, energy sensing, and other multi-dimensional information. - Contextual advice: Understanding your specific life situation to provide highly personalized guidance. - Emotional support: Providing empathy and psychological support during difficult life periods. - Experiential intuition: Intuitive pattern recognition for rare chart configurations built through decades of practice. - Dynamic dialogue: Adjusting analysis direction and depth based on your reactions and feedback in real-time.
The ideal approach may be to use AI for foundational analysis and data computation, and human practitioners for deep interpretation and personalized guidance. The two are complementary, not mutually exclusive.
How to Judge the Quality of an AI BaZi Reading
Regardless of which AI tool you use, here are quality benchmarks:
Green Flags
- Clearly identifies your day master, chart pattern, and Useful God - Analysis conclusions include specific logical reasoning - Distinguishes between high-certainty judgments and probabilistic assessments - Acknowledges analytical limitations - Branch interactions are completely identified - Luck pillar timing is precisely calculated
Red Flags
- Excessive hedging ("maybe," "perhaps") without any clear conclusions - Analysis content that seems applicable to any chart - No pattern or Useful God identification, just vague advice - Claims to predict specific events at specific times with certainty - Fear-based language implying disasters to drive paid "remedies" - Incorrect year pillar stem and branch calculation (the most basic verification)
Frequently Asked Questions
What is the difference between AI BaZi analysis and just asking ChatGPT?
When you ask ChatGPT directly, the model must calculate the chart and apply metaphysics rules on its own, with a high error rate. Professional AI BaZi platforms like Deep Oracle use rigorously tested deterministic engines to pre-compute all analytical data. The LLM only transforms these verified data into readable text.
Can AI replace traditional fortune tellers?
Not entirely, at present. AI excels in rule-based analytical dimensions but lacks the holistic perception, contextual advice, and emotional support that experienced human practitioners provide. For a detailed comparison, see our AI vs Traditional Fortune Telling analysis.
What are the 2,494 tests?
These are software engineering "unit tests" — each test defines a specific input (e.g., a particular birth chart) and expected output (e.g., this chart should be identified as Direct Officer pattern), then automatically verifies whether the engine's output matches expectations. All tests run automatically with every code update.
What is the actual accuracy rate?
"Accuracy" depends on which dimension you measure. For rule-based dimensions like pattern determination, the tested deterministic engines approach 100% accuracy. For subjective dimensions like the applicability of life advice, a simple percentage is not meaningful. We choose to honestly distinguish these two categories rather than citing a single misleading number. For specific model test results on pattern recognition, see our AI accuracy test data.
Are free AI BaZi readings reliable?
Reliability depends on the underlying technical architecture, not the price. The key question is: does it let the LLM calculate the chart directly, or does it have independent deterministic engines? Are there automated tests ensuring calculation correctness? You can do a basic verification by checking whether the year pillar stems and branches are correct.
Further Reading
- Try AI BaZi Analysis Free — Enter your birth time to experience Deep Oracle's hybrid deterministic engine + LLM analysis - How AI BaZi Analysis Works — A deep look at the deterministic engine implementation - AI vs Traditional Fortune Telling — Where AI and human practitioners each excel - How Accurate Is BaZi? — Exploring accuracy from the perspective of Chinese metaphysics itself - AI Fortune Telling Accuracy Test — Pattern recognition test data across 6 AI models
Related Articles
AI vs Human Fortune Tellers: An Honest Side-by-Side Comparison
AI vs human fortune tellers compared across consistency, speed, cost, depth, and personalization. An honest assessment of when to use each | deeporacle.ai
Period 9 Fire & Five Elements: Is Your BaZi Thriving?
Discover how Period 9 Fire influences your Five Elements and BaZi chart, with balanced insight into who may thrive or feel challenged | deeporacle.ai
DeepSeek & ChatGPT BaZi Limits: Why They Fall Short
DeepSeek and ChatGPT can't do real BaZi: 5 blind spots in generic AI fortune telling and what professional chart analysis actually requires | deeporacle.ai
Ready to explore your own chart?
Classical citations · Rigorous pattern verification · Free overview
Try Free